Envronville (French pronunciation: [ɑ̃vʁɔ̃vil]) is a commune in the Seine-Maritime department in the Normandy region in northern France.

Geography

A

farming village situated in the Pays de Caux, some 26 miles (42 km) northeast of Le Havre
, at the junction of the D29 and the D5 roads.

Places of interest

  • The church of Notre-Dame, dating from the thirteenth century.
